Description:
Jubilee Overture is a radiant and festive work composed by Jean-François Michel to celebrate the virtuosity and musicality of the trombone quartet. Dedicated to the renowned Slokar Quartet, this piece pays tribute to their artistry and significant contribution to the brass repertoire. From the very first bars, the work unfolds a luminous energy, carried by sparkling motifs and a concise rhythmic writing. Jean-François Michel uses all his skills, alternating between majestic passages and more lyrical moments in which the timbres of the four trombones blend elegantly. The harmonic language, both modern and accessible, lends the overture a solemn character that is nevertheless in constant motion. The carefully structured dialogues between the voices emphasize the precision and interplay of the ensemble. A true celebration of sound, Jubilee Overture is an outstanding work in the contemporary repertoire for trombone quartet. It impressively conveys the spirit of festivity, virtuosity and unity that characterizes the art of the Slokar Quartet and at the same time reflects the creativity and inspiration of Jean-François Michel.
